    My grandmother bought this and we are unsure what it is. "GENERAL NO. *10 MADE IN U.S.A" is imprinted on the top of it.

    3. Meowman Meowman, 7 years ago
      not entirely sure but I've seen similar devices used with a sharpening wheel, for sharpening chisels, plane blades and other similar things. This allows the item being sharpened to be held at the proper angle steadily as it sharpens.
